Understanding Others

Science Cafe

Available for over a year

Adam Walton explores breakdowns in understanding between neurodivergent and neurotypical people, asking how we can better communicate with each other. Joining Adam is Autism Researcher, Dr Gemma Williams, who introduces us to her book 'Understanding Others in a Neurodiverse World: A Radical Perspective on Communication and Shared Meaning'. Plus, we hear from Filmmaker, Sam Grierson, whose latest film 'The Programme' explores loneliness and grief from the perspective of a non-binary and neurodivergent ex-police officer, played by Michelle Jeram. Produced by Stuart Russell.
